FWSL: Kampala Queens Beat Frustrated Asubo-Gafford

Kampala Queens extended it’s unbeaten run to ten games as the side rallied from behind to beat the frustrated Asubo Gafford Ladies by 3-1 in a match played on 5th,February ,2023 at Kampala Quality play ground.

The three goals came from Elizabeth Nakigozi,Magret Kunuhira and Substitute Sophia Nakiyingi and the one goal for Gafford was scored by Zaitun Namaganda.

Namaganda,Gafford’s new signing from Tagy High School,drew the first blood for the hosts in the 25th minute, when she obtained a brilliant pass from Musimenta, beating two Kampala Queens defenders to score from close range to put the hosts into the lead.

The same player Namaganda was denied what looked to be a penalty after she was fouled by the Kampala Queens defender in the 30th minute.

In the added minutes of the first half ,the hosts happiness was cut short when Elizabeth Nakigozi shot from close range when the defenders of the Asubo-Gafford Ladies failed to control the ball finding the lady in the right place to bring the palace Queens back in the game.

Early in the second half ,the visitors came determined and indeed their strength was exhibited in the 46th minute when Margret Kunihira got a through pass from Nassuna to double the lead. 

The rest of the minutes on the pitch were for Kampala Queens pressing hard to score as many goals to create very good differences .

Towards the end of the game in 87minutes,the substitute Sophia Nakiyingi scored the third goal for the visitors putting them in the comfortable zone .

The win takes them to 30 points with 11 points gap between them and Martyrs the second placed side that lost their game 1-0 against Rines FC and the loss for hosts leaves them in the last position with only four points.

Despite accepting a loss, Asubo-Gafford Ladies gaffer Rogers Nkugwa wasn’t happy with the decision of FUFA not releasing his players in time which disorganized his preparations.

“We lost the game,we wanted three points but didn’t work out, we had a chance to kill the game in first half but the girls were not clinical enough.” Says Nkugwa.

Among the players Nkugwa much wanted to use was Kamiyat, they club signed from Tagy High School but he failed to use her due to late clearance.

“Yes I was planned a lot on her because our biggest challenge is scoring but FUFA delayed to clear her and the other two in Sarah Nakuya and Zaitun Namaganda were only cleared in the morning, so that disorganize the preparation of the team but I believe by next game she will be available.” 

Asubo will be paying a short visit to Lubaga to play against Uganda Martyrs.
